Advanced Specifications and Manufacturing Excellence at 409L Stainless Steel Coil Factory
A reputable 409L stainless steel coil factory produces premium-grade ferritic material engineered with 10.5-11.75% chromium, minimal nickel content, and stabilized titanium additions creating superior weldability and resistance to intergranular corrosion in high-temperature applications. Leading 409L stainless steel coil factory facilities implement advanced metallurgical processes including precision melting, controlled casting, and optimized rolling sequences ensuring consistent chemical composition and mechanical property uniformity across every production batch. Thickness specifications available from 409L stainless steel coil factory typically range from 0.3 mm to 3.0 mm with standard widths between 1000-1500 mm, accommodating diverse manufacturing requirements from precision automotive components to heavy industrial equipment. Advanced quality control systems integrated throughout 409L stainless steel coil factory operations include spectroscopic analysis, mechanical testing, flatness verification, and comprehensive documentation ensuring certification to ASTM A240 and international standards. The 409L stainless steel coil factory produces both hot-rolled and cold-rolled variants with multiple surface finishes including No.1, 2B, and customized options, supporting specialized aesthetic and functional requirements.
Superior Performance Characteristics and Manufacturing Capabilities of 409L Stainless Steel Coil Factory
A modern 409L stainless steel coil factory delivers material with exceptional high-temperature oxidation resistance up to 815°C (1500°F), combined with excellent thermal fatigue resistance and superior stress rupture properties critical for demanding automotive and industrial applications. The titanium stabilization process employed by 409L stainless steel coil factory prevents chromium carbide precipitation during welding, ensuring superior intergranular corrosion resistance and eliminating post-weld heat treatment requirements in most fabrication scenarios. Advanced manufacturing infrastructure at 409L stainless steel coil factory enables tight dimensional tolerances of ±0.05 mm thickness variation and ±3 mm width deviation, supporting high-precision stamping and complex fabrication operations with minimal scrap rates. Mechanical properties offered by 409L stainless steel coil factory include tensile strength approximately 415-585 MPa, yield strength near 205-310 MPa, and elongation around 20-30%, delivering reliable performance in structural and thermal applications. Superior cost-effectiveness of material produced by 409L stainless steel coil factory results from lower alloying costs compared to austenitic grades, enabling significant material cost savings while maintaining essential performance characteristics.
